Device Story

Intrauterine pressure catheter (IUPC) for intrapartum monitoring; features pressure-sensing membrane cavity at tip (internal or external mount); includes port for amnioinfusion and amniotic fluid sampling; sterile, single-patient use; includes introducer for placement; system utilizes reusable cable and transducer. Used in clinical setting by healthcare providers for monitoring uterine contractions; provides pressure data to assist in labor management; benefits include reduced risk of cross-contamination via disposable design and soft tip to minimize perforation risk.

Clinical Evidence

Bench testing verified sensor accuracy, mechanical integrity, and overall performance. Biocompatibility testing confirmed material safety. No specific clinical trial data or performance metrics (e.g., sensitivity/specificity) provided in the summary.

Technological Characteristics

Sterile, single-patient use intrauterine pressure catheter. Features: pressure-sensing membrane cavity at tip, soft tip, insertion markings, female luer connector for amnioinfusion/sampling. System includes reusable cable and transducer. External zeroing of pressure. Materials are biocompatible.

Regulatory Classification

Identification

An intrauterine pressure monitor is a device designed to detect and measure intrauterine and amniotic fluid pressure with a catheter placed transcervically into the uterine cavity. The device is used to monitor intensity, duration, and frequency of uterine contractions during labor. This generic type of device may include the following accessories: signal analysis and display equipment, patient and equipment supports, and component parts.

Cottonwood St., Murray, UT 84107 Telephone: (801) 268-8200 Fax: (801) 266-7373 Proprietary Names: Koala Intrauterine Pressure Catheter and Koala External Intrauterine Pressure Catheter Common/Usual Name: Intrauterine Pressure Monitor and Accessories Classification Name: Monitor, Pressure, Intrauterine The legally marketed devices to which equivalence is claimed are the Medex MX 4041 Intrauterine Pressure Catheter, Graphic Controls Life Trace 3000 Intrauterine Pressure Catheter System, and Utah Medical Products Intran Plus IUP Catheter. Description of the device: An intrauterine pressure catheter with a pressure-sensing membrane cavity at the tip (either inside the catheter or mounted externally), a port for amnioinfusion and amniotic fluid sampling, and an introducer which is removed after placement. This product is a sterile, single patient use catheter. The system includes a reusable cable with a reusable pressure transducer. Intended use: This catheter is for use on patients requiring intrapartum, intrauterine pressure monitoring. The Koala IPC’s are substantially equivalent to the predicate devices because: they have the same intended uses, namely, intrauterine pressure measurement and monitoring and amniotic fluid access, and - they have the same basic technological characteristics as predicate devices, namely, pressure sensor located at catheter tip, - soft tip for low risk of perforation, - markings for catheter insertion, - low-cost disposable in order to avoid cross contamination, - port and lumen with female luer connector for access to amniotic space, and - external zeroing of pressure. They use the same or similar materials, all of which have been shown to be biocompatible and to function well in the intended application. The safety and effectiveness are similar to existing devices as demonstrated in the laboratory and in clinical testing. Biocompatibility testing shows that the materials used Page 10 {1} Koala & Koala External IUPC Clinical Innovations, Inc. in the Koala IPC and the Koala External IPC are safe for this application. Effectiveness is the same as the predicate devices. The laboratory testing verified the performance in terms of sensor accuracy, mechanical integrity, and overall performance. Wm.
